  All children must be dressed for class in proper attire or they will not be able to participate:  All accessory clothing must be free of buttons, buckles, zippers, or hoods to prevent injury to the gymnast and damage to the apparatus.  


There is No JEWELERY allowed on the gym floor.  Children are allowed to wear POST EARINGS only!  Through our extensive experience, jewelry gets lost, broken and can hurt the child when performing skills, so for this reason we implore you to keep your children’s valuables safely at home.
